Fuel Jettison (or dumping) is used during non normal operations.

 

If you have to divert to an alternate airport for whatever reason and are above max landing mass, then you have two options:

 

1) Overweight landing

The Overweight landing checklist will guide you.

 

2) dump fuel so you can do a landing at max landing mass (or less).

The FUEL JETTISON checklist shows you step by step what to do and what buttons to press. (make sure you open up the correct checklist from the menu though as some are named similar).

Just press the checklist button, navigate to non normals, fuel, fuel jettison.

(the last part of the checklist "fuel jettison complete - yes/no" is left open untill all the fuel you wanted to dump has been dumped. Then you enter YES and finish the checklist).
